I. Understanding PIM


A PIM system allows businesses to gather, centralize, and enrich product data from various internal and external sources, ensuring consistent, accurate information is shared across platforms, channels, and systems. By streamlining this data, manufacturers can improve data quality, meet compliance standards, enhance the supply chain, and create a more competitive edge. The ultimate goal is to deliver a seamless, reliable customer experience.

Why Manufacturers Need PIM


Manufacturers face multiple hurdles, from keeping product data consistent across various regions to managing intricate product customizations, pricing, and languages. PIM systems are essential to ensure faster time-to-market, handle real-time synchronization of product information, and overcome complex challenges to thrive in a competitive market.

II. Challenges Faced by Manufacturers


Data Silos and Inconsistencies
Fragmented data leads to inefficient workflows and can tarnish a brand's reputation if inconsistencies reach the customer. Siloed systems often result from outdated methods of data management, where teams exchange information in isolated environments like emails or project-specific tools. This leads to duplication of efforts, slower approval processes, and a lack of collaboration.

Meeting Multi-Channel Demands
As manufacturers expand their global presence, they must continuously collaborate with retailers and adhere to specific timelines and data formats. However, rushed processes often result in lower-quality data being shared, leading to discrepancies when the retailers fail to update their systems.

Slow Time-to-Market
Traditional methods, such as manually editing product data sheets, slow down product launches and increase the likelihood of errors. This not only impacts the time-to-market but also reduces the manufacturer’s ability to make real-time adjustments to product information, giving competitors an advantage.

III. Benefits of PIM


Enhanced Data Quality and Efficiency
PIM systems improve data consistency by centralizing product information and reducing errors. Standardized templates and automated processes streamline data management and ensure compliance across the board, empowering manufacturers to make informed decisions.

Multi-Channel Management
PIM simplifies the management of product data across various channels, such as eCommerce sites, marketplaces, and social media. Centralizing this data ensures consistency and accuracy, enhancing the overall customer experience and strengthening the brand.

Faster Time-to-Market
PIM helps manufacturers launch products more quickly by automating workflows and synchronizing data across platforms. This enables rapid product updates and reduces delays, making manufacturers more agile and competitive.

Higher ROI
By automating workflows, minimizing errors, and improving data quality, PIM systems enable manufacturers to scale efficiently, reduce costs, and improve overall return on investment. PIM also supports quick market expansion, localization efforts, and streamlined business processes.

Scalability and Flexibility
A robust PIM system is scalable, allowing manufacturers to onboard new products and users with ease. The ability to customize and adapt to changing business needs is key to maintaining a competitive edge in the market.

Improved Customer Experience
With accurate, consistent product information delivered across all channels, manufacturers can build trust with their customers. AI-powered PIM systems can also personalize product recommendations, resulting in higher customer satisfaction and loyalty.

Compliance and Regulation
PIM systems help manufacturers adhere to industry standards, regulations, and data protection laws. By ensuring real-time updates and proper version control, PIM enables businesses to stay compliant while avoiding penalties.
